Book Description:

Chasing the High is a hybrid biography that traces the extraordinary life of Richard T. Sanchez from a childhood marked by addiction, instability, and the shadow of a father behind bars, to a career on the front lines of the modern drug war as a Texas lawman and federal agent. Told through a gripping blend of cinematic third-person storytelling and Richard’s own brutally honest first-person reflections, the book reveals the inner battles behind the badge, the ghosts that never stopped following him, and the unlikely path that led him out of the life he was born into and into the life he was never supposed to have. As cartels evolved into militarized empires and violence seeped across borders, Sanchez found himself confronting not only the criminals in front of him, but the boy he used to be. Deeply human and unforgettable, this is a story of survival, identity, leadership, faith, and the hard-won peace that comes after the adrenaline fades.

About the Author: Richard T. Sanchez

Richard T. Sanchez is a former Texas lawman and highly decorated DEA Special Agent whose career placed him at the center of major narcotics investigations during a period of rapid cartel evolution and intensifying cross-border violence. Known for his leadership under pressure and his commitment to the mission, Sanchez’s story is also one of personal transformation; overcoming a traumatic upbringing to build a life of service. Chasing the High is his definitive account of the road from survival to purpose, and the internal cost of the work.
